Quote:
Originally Posted by miguelruiz064 View Post
Nissan apparently finally fixed the CSC issue in 2018 with the Exide clutch and a softer pressure plate, so if you can find one in stock go for it.
I call

They didn't change the shitty design of the CSC. I don't believe a softer pressure plate is going to change jack. That rubber lining is not going stand up. I'll believe it when I hear the majority of 2018 owners did not have to change their CSC before their clutch.

Quote:
Originally Posted by miguelruiz064 View Post
I'm not a fan of the CSC delete kit. Every single modern manual car uses a concentric slave cylinder; going to the external slave cylinder seems backwards to me but hey, it works; if you like this design better it's only a matter of taste.
So get the ZSpeed or Tilton heavy duty internal. It's not like a delete kit is the only aftermarket option.
